CloudLinux is a global remote-first company. We are driven by our principles: Do the right thing, employees first, we are remote first, and we deliver high volume, low-cost Linux infrastructure and security products that help companies to increase the efficiency of their operations. Every person on our team supports each other and does what we can to ensure everyone is successful. We are truly a great place to work. For more details about our company go to Cloudlinux.com.
Imunify Security is an innovative security solution, powered by Artificial Intelligence for Linux web servers. It is designed specifically for shared and VPS/Dedicated servers. The automated, easy-to-use security solution with the six-layer approach to security delivers comprehensive and complete attack prevention.
Work is fully remote, so you can work from anywhere.
More details about the project you can find on the product website Imunify360.com, and about the company on Cloudlinux.com.
Join us to make a difference!
What you will do:
- Be involved in the development of Imunify360 products using Python.
- Cover your code with unit tests and/or functional tests.
- Review of code written by your colleagues using Gerrit.
- Architecture development and writing technical documentation for new features.
- Investigating issues reported by our clients, partners, or support team.
Requirements:
Qualifications that we are looking for:
- 3+ years of Python programming experience.
- Experience in system programming: sockets, filesystem, process management
- Experience with Linux servers administration is a huge plus
- Experience with network security is a plus
- Experience with automated testing and CI/CD systems is a plus
- Knowledge about rpm/deb package management is a plus
- Intermediate level of English language.
Personal skills:
- Fast-learning, proactivity.
- Strong self-motivation, driven to achieve committed milestones.
- Strong prioritization skills and a flexible mindset
- The ability to independently analyze a task and find the right solution.
- The ability to work with vague requirements and making independent decisions
- The ability to work in a team.
Benefits:
What's in it for you?
- A focus on professional development;
- Training reimbursements
- Mentor programs
- Knowledge-Exchange programs
- Interesting and challenging projects
- Flexible working hours
- Paid 24 days of vacation per year and unlimited sick leave
- Medical insurance reimbursement
- Co-working and gym/sports reimbursement
- The opportunity to receive a reward for the most innovative idea that the company can patent.